We compared two Desktop platform GPUs: 8GB VRAM RTX A5000 8Q and 256MB VRAM ATI Radeon HD 2400 XT to see which GPU has better performance in key specifications, benchmark tests, power consumption, etc.
Main Differences
NVIDIA RTX A5000-8Q 's Advantages
Released 13 years and 10 months late
Boost Clock1695MHz
Larger VRAM bandwidth (768.0GB/s vs 8.000GB/s)
8152 additional rendering cores
ATI Radeon HD 2400 XT 's Advantages
Lower TDP (25W vs 230W)
